Connection interruption via repeated TLS handshakes
Published May 28, 2024 · Updated Feb 13, 2025
Incomplete connection-state tracking in Kwik commit 745fd4e2 allows remote attackers to interrupt QUIC connections via repeated TLS messages. Agent15's TLS server engine accepts later Client Hello and Finished messages without enforcing handshake state, replacing cryptographic parameters established by earlier messages. The exploitation path requires visibility into a victim's initial QUIC packets and an undiscarded Initial key; it desynchronizes the connection and enables hijacking after a forged Finished message.
